e. Independent Learning Factor
According to Basri 1994:54 independent learning factor as follows:
1 Internal Factor The factors come from inside of their self like natural ability and
intellectual potency. a Physic Aspects Physiological:
1 Physical conditional: A healthy physical state would be very effect on the independence of the student learning. Fresh
constitution would be different from less fresh constitution. 2 Sensory function: Senses is a tool that is capable of capturing
stimuli to be processed immediately in self private students. Everyone was able to see the world and learning by using the
senses. Condition functions good senses will be one important factor in the activities undertaken by the students.
b Psychic Aspects Psychological Sardiman A.M 2012: 45 stated that at least there is 8
psycological factors that affect people to do learning activity. Which is attention, observation, feed back, fantation, memory,
thinking, talent and motive. These factors can be described as follows:
1 Attention Concern is the level of awareness of students who centered
on an object lesson. The more perfect the attention of the students will be more perfect as well learning activities
undertaken learners. Because of it, the teacher should always strive to attract attention their students to achieve student
learning independence optimal. 2 Observation
Observation is a way to know the real world, either themselves and their environment with all the senses.
Sardiman, 2012: 45. Muhibbin Syah 2010: 117stated that observation means that the process receive, interpret, and
give meaning to stimuli enter through the senses such as eyes and ears. The learning experience of students will be able to
achieve a true and objective observations before reaching understanding.
3 Response Response is picture memory after making observations. So,
observation process has stopped and just stay impression only. The response will affect the learning behavior of each
student. Sardiman 2012: 45.
